1. Credit and Debit Cards
Credit and debit cards remain one of the most popular methods for online casino deposits. Visa and Mastercard are the two leading brands that players frequently utilize.
Advantages:
- Speed: Deposits made via credit or debit cards are typically processed instantly, allowing players to start gaming without delay.
- Widespread Acceptance: Most online casinos accept credit and debit cards, making them a convenient choice for many players.
- Familiarity: Many players feel comfortable using cards they already own, and card transactions are straightforward.
Disadvantages:
- Withdrawal Limitations: While deposits are instant, withdrawals can take longer, often requiring additional verification steps.
- Bank Restrictions: Some banks may block transactions to online gambling sites, which can be a hurdle for players.
2. E-Wallets
E-wallets like PayPal, Skrill, and Neteller have gained immense popularity in the online gambling community due to their speed and security features.
Advantages:
- Instant Transactions: Deposits through e-wallets are processed almost instantly, allowing for immediate access to funds.
- Enhanced Security: E-wallets add an extra layer of security, as players do not have to share their bank details with casinos.
- Easy Withdrawals: Many e-wallets offer quicker withdrawal times compared to traditional banking methods.
Disadvantages:
- Fees: Some e-wallet services charge fees for transactions, which can add up over time.
- Limited Acceptance: Not all online casinos accept every e-wallet, so players should check availability before choosing this option.
3. Prepaid Cards
Prepaid cards such as Paysafecard allow players to deposit funds without the need for a bank account or credit card.
Advantages:
- Anonymity: Players can deposit funds without revealing personal banking information, providing a level of anonymity.
- Budget Control: Since prepaid cards are loaded with a specific amount, they help players manage their gambling budget effectively.
- Instant Deposits: Deposits are processed instantly, allowing for immediate gameplay.
Disadvantages:
- No Withdrawals: Prepaid cards can only be used for deposits, meaning players will need an alternative method for withdrawals.
- Availability: Not all casinos accept prepaid cards, limiting options for players.
4. Cryptocurrencies
With the rise of digital currencies, many online casinos now accept c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Litecoin for deposits.
Advantages:
- Fast Transactions: Cryptocurrency deposits are typically processed within minutes, making them one of the fastest options available.
- High Security: Cryptocurrencies utilize blockchain technology, offering enhanced security and anonymity.
- Low Fees: Transaction fees for cryptocurrency deposits are often lower than traditional banking methods.
Disadvantages:
- Volatility: The value of cryptocurrencies can fluctuate significantly, which may affect the amount of funds available for gaming.
- Learning Curve: New players may find the process of purchasing and using cryptocurrencies complicated.
5. Bank Transfers
Bank transfers, including wire transfers and ACH transfers, are traditional methods for depositing funds into online casinos.
Advantages:
- High Limits: Bank transfers typically allow for larger deposits compared to other methods.
- Security: Transactions are secure and regulated by banking institutions, providing peace of mind for players.
Disadvantages:
- Slow Processing Times: Bank transfers can take several days to process, delaying access to funds.
- Complexity: The process can be cumbersome, requiring players to input various banking details.
6. Mobile Payment Solutions
Mobile payment options like Apple Pay and Google Pay are becoming increasingly popular among online casino players.
Advantages:
- Convenience: Players can make deposits directly from their mobile devices, making it a convenient option for on-the-go gaming.
- Instant Transactions: Deposits are typically processed instantly, allowing for immediate access to funds.
- Security Features: Many mobile payment solutions offer enhanced security features, such as biometric authentication.
Disadvantages:
- Limited Acceptance: Not all online casinos accept mobile payment solutions, so players should verify availability.
- Device Dependency: Players must have a compatible device to use mobile payment options.
